Why
Emotional Awareness Matters...
Emotions influence how people relate to themselves and those around them. When our own emotions, or the emotions of others, are not understood, this may lead to reactive patterns, avoidance, or conflict.
​
Emotionally Focused Therapy (EFT) provides clients the opportunity to gain insight into emotional responses, and how to engage with their emotions in a way that supports healthier communication, closer relationships, and personal growth.
